PREP: 10 MINUTES  COOK: 7 MINUTES 

INGREDIENTS

2 cups sugar 

2/3 cup light corn syrup 

2 teaspoons enhanced concentrate, for example, mint or vanilla (discretionary; See Kelly's Notes) 

Grouped sprinkles or candy 

Candy sticks 

Uncommon EQUIPMENT: 

candy thermometer

Guidelines 


Line two enormous preparing sheets with material paper or Silpat heating mats. Fill an enormous bowl with ice water and put it in a safe spot. 

Join the sugar, corn syrup and 1/4 cup water in a little pot set over medium warmth. Join the treats thermometer to the inside of the pan. 

Increment the warmth to medium-high to heat the blend to the point of boiling, mixing until the sugar has disolved. Utilizing a little cake brush dunked in water, wash down the sides of the pot to keep gems from framing. 

Heat up the blend for 5 to 7 minutes until it arrives at 310°F (hard-break stage) on the treats thermometer. Quickly move the pan to the bowl of ice water, cautiously lowering the sides yet guaranteeing no water saturates it. Twirl the prospect to 15 seconds to enable the blend to cool at that point expel the pot from the bowl of ice water. In case you're utilizing a concentrate, cautiously twirl it into the blend following you expel the pan from the ice shower. 

Working rapidly, pour the syrup onto the heating sheets to frame circles that are 2 to 3 crawls in width. (Space the candies 3 to 4 inches separated to ensure they don't run into one another.) Immediately press in the candy sticks and sprinkle the candies with your sprinkles or candy, gently squeezing the embellishments into the syrup. Let cool totally until completely solidified at that point cautiously strip the candies off the heating sheet. 

NOTES: 


Settle on a concentrate that is clear in shading so as to keep up the perfectly clear shade of the candies. 

It's a lot simpler to neatly pour the syrup onto the heating sheet on the off chance that you utilize a pan with a pour spot. 

Work rapidly when you expel the syrup from the oven, as it'll solidify rapidly. On the off chance that the syrup gets excessively hard, re-warm it over medium warmth until it relax somewhat.
